CCI(Commodity Channel Index)是一个常用的技术分析指标,主要用于衡量市场的超买和超卖状况。它的基础释义为:CCI是一种基于价格变动的指标,用于测量市场的超买和超卖状况。当价格超过一定的极端范围时,CCI会发出警告信号,表明市场可能处于过热或过冷状态,需要投资者关注。
